הביצוע מתחיל בשאילתת ניתוח מאוחסנת. התוצאות ייכתבו לטבלת היעד שצוינה ב-BigQuery. ניתן להשתמש בשם הפעולה שמוחזר כדי לעבור על סטטוס ההשלמה של שאילתה.
בקשת HTTP
POST https://adsdatahub.googleapis.com/v1/{name=customers/*/analysisQueries/*}:start
כתובת ה-URL כוללת תחביר gRPC קידוד מחדש.
פרמטרים של נתיב
פרמטרים | |
---|---|
name |
שם משאב מלא, למשל 'customers/123/analysisQuery/abcd1234'. |
גוף הבקשה
גוף הבקשה מכיל נתונים במבנה הבא:
ייצוג JSON |
---|
{
"spec": {
object ( |
שדות | |
---|---|
spec |
מגדיר את הפרמטרים לביצוע השאילתה. |
destTable |
טבלת יעדים של BigQuery לתוצאות שאילתה בפורמט 'project.dataset.table_name'. אם תציינו זאת, הפרויקט חייב להיכלל ברשימת ההיתרים מפורשות לחשבון ADH של הלקוח. אם לא צוין פרויקט, המערכת משתמשת בפרויקט ברירת המחדל עבור הלקוח שסופק. אם לא צוין פרויקט או מערך נתונים, המערכת משתמשת בפרויקט ובמערך הנתונים שמוגדרים כברירת מחדל. |
customerId |
אופציונלי. לקוח של Data Data Hub מבצע את השאילתה. אם לא הוקש דבר, ברירת המחדל היא הלקוח שבבעלותו השאילתה. |
גוף התגובה
אם התגובה מוצלחת, גוף התגובה מכיל מופע של Operation
.
היקפי הרשאה
יש צורך בהיקף OAuth הבא:
https://www.googleapis.com/auth/adsdatahub